The history of chicken pot pie
Chicken pot pie is a classic comfort food that has been enjoyed by many for decades. This dish consists of a creamy chicken and vegetable filling encased in a buttery pastry crust. The origins of chicken pot pie can be traced back to medieval times when pies were filled with meat and vegetables. These pies were usually made with a thick crust and served as a complete meal.
The early version of chicken pot pie may have been created in England in the 16th century. This dish was made by placing meat and vegetables in a clay pot and then covering them with a pastry crust. The pot was then placed in the oven until the crust was golden brown and the filling was cooked through. In the 19th century, chicken pot pie became a popular dish in America and was often served as a Sunday dinner. It was considered a hearty and filling meal that could feed a large family.
The popularity of chicken pot pie continued throughout the 20th century, and it became a staple in many American households. In the 1950s and 60s, frozen pot pies became popular as they were convenient and easy to prepare. Today, chicken pot pie is still a beloved dish and is enjoyed in many different variations all around the world. There are even vegetarian and vegan versions of this classic recipe to accommodate people with different dietary needs.

Ingredients:
- 1 pound cooked chicken, shredded
- 1 can (10.5 oz) cream of chicken soup
- 1 cup frozen mixed vegetables
- 1 refrigerated pie crust
- 1 egg, beaten (optional)
Instructions:
1. Preheat your oven to 375°F (190°C).
2. In a large mixing bowl, combine the cooked chicken, cream of chicken soup, and frozen mixed vegetables. Mix well.
3. Transfer the mixture to a 9-inch pie dish.
4. Unroll the refrigerated pie crust and place it on top of the pie dish, covering the chicken mixture. Press the edges of the crust onto the rim of the dish to seal it.
5. If desired, you can use a pastry brush to brush the beaten egg over the top of the pie crust. This will give it a nice golden color when it’s baked.
6. Make several slits on the top of the crust to allow steam to escape during baking.
7. Place the pie dish on a baking sheet and bake it for about 40-45 minutes, or until the crust is golden brown and crispy.
Your chicken pot pie is now ready to serve. Let it cool for a few minutes before slicing and serving.
Tips and Tricks:
- You can add different seasonings to the chicken mixture to give it more flavor. Try adding some salt, pepper, garlic powder, or onion powder.
- If you don’t have frozen mixed vegetables, you can use any combination of vegetables you like. Peas, carrots, green beans, and corn are all good options.
- You can use a homemade pie crust instead of a refrigerated one if you prefer.
- If you want to make a larger pie, you can double the recipe and use a 9×13 inch baking dish. Just be sure to adjust the baking time accordingly.
- If the crust is browning too quickly, you can cover it with a piece of foil halfway through the baking time.

The Five Essential Ingredients for a Delicious Chicken Pot Pie
Chicken pot pie is a classic dish that is loved by many. Warm, hearty, and delicious, it is a perfect meal for chilly nights and family gatherings. The best part about this recipe is that it doesn’t require a lot of ingredients to make it. Here are five essential ingredients for a delicious chicken pot pie.
The Chicken
The most important ingredient in a chicken pot pie is, of course, the chicken. For the best results, use boneless, skinless chicken breasts or thighs. You can either cook them in advance or use store-bought rotisserie chicken for an added flavor. Cut the chicken into small pieces to make it easier to mix with the rest of the filling. Season it with salt, pepper, and your favorite herbs, such as thyme or rosemary, for an extra flavorful kick.
The Vegetables
The second essential ingredient in a chicken pot pie is the vegetables. You can use any combination of vegetables that you like, such as carrots, peas, celery, or green beans. Make sure to chop them into small pieces so that they cook evenly and blend well with the chicken. Precook the vegetables to ensure they are soft and tender before adding them to the pie crust. You can also add some onions and garlic to the mix for extra taste.
The Pie Crust
The third essential ingredient for a delicious chicken pot pie is the pie crust. You can use a store-bought crust or prepare it yourself at home. Making a pie crust from scratch is not as difficult as it may seem, and it adds a homemade touch to the recipe. Use a combination of flour, butter, salt, and ice-cold water to make the crust dough. Roll it out into a thin layer, big enough to fit your baking dish. Place the crust on the bottom of your dish and add the chicken and vegetables on top. Cover the filling with another layer of crust, seal the edges, and make small slits in the top to allow the steam to escape.
The Sauce
The fourth essential ingredient for a delicious chicken pot pie is the sauce. The sauce is what gives the filling its creamy texture and richness. You can make a traditional white sauce using butter, flour, and milk, or a more flavorful sauce using chicken broth or cream. Mix the sauce with the chicken and vegetables until well blended, adding a pinch of salt and pepper to taste. Pour the mixture into the prepared crust, making sure it reaches all the corners, and cover with the other crust layer.
The Egg Wash
The final essential ingredient for a delicious chicken pot pie is the egg wash. An egg wash is a mixture of beaten eggs and water used to brush the top of the pie crust before baking. The egg wash gives the crust a golden brown color and a glossy finish. To prepare the egg wash, beat one egg with a tablespoon of water until well combined. Brush the egg wash over the top of the crust, making sure to cover all the surface. Bake the chicken pot pie in the oven for about 45-50 minutes or until the crust is golden brown and the filling is hot and bubbly. Let it cool for a few minutes before serving.

Tips and tricks for making the perfect crust for your chicken pot pie
When it comes to chicken pot pie, the crust is just as important as the filling. A perfect crust is flaky and golden brown and is the perfect compliment to the delicious, creamy filling. If you’ve never made a crust before, don’t worry – it’s not as difficult as it may seem. Here are tips and tricks to help you make the perfect crust for your chicken pot pie.
Use the right type of flour
The flour you use is critical in making a good crust. It’s important to use all-purpose flour for the right texture. Other types of flour, such as bread flour or cake flour, have different protein contents and will result in a tougher or crumbly crust. All-purpose flour, on the other hand, has the perfect amount of protein to give your crust the right balance of flakiness and tenderness.
Keep your ingredients cold
The key to a flaky crust is keeping everything cold. Your butter or shortening should be chilled, and you should use ice water when making your dough. This keeps the fat from melting and causing the dough to become greasy. When the dough is baked, the melting fat creates steam, which helps to create flaky layers in the crust.
Don’t overwork the dough
Once the dough is mixed, it’s important not to overwork it. Overworking the dough can result in a tough crust. Handle it gently and use a light touch. When rolling out the dough, use quick and firm strokes, and avoid rolling and re-rolling the dough. This can cause the dough to become tough. If you need to reposition the dough, lift it up and move it rather than sliding it across the surface.
Use the right type of fat
Fat is an important ingredient in a crust. You can use butter, shortening, or a combination of the two. Butter adds flavor, while shortening adds tenderness and flakiness. When using butter, make sure it’s cold and cut it into small pieces before adding it to the dry ingredients. You can also use a food processor to cut in the butter or shortening, which saves time and effort.
Brush with an egg wash
Before baking your chicken pot pie, it’s important to brush the crust with an egg wash. This will give your crust a beautiful golden brown color and a shiny finish. To make an egg wash, beat an egg with a tablespoon of water and brush it over the crust with a pastry brush. Make sure to brush the edges as well.

Variations on the classic chicken pot pie recipe
Chicken Pot Pie is a classic dish that everyone loves. It’s perfect for a cozy dinner on a cold winter night and a hearty meal that can be enjoyed any time of year. Here are five variations on the classic recipe that you should definitely try.
1. Turkey Pot Pie
If you have leftover turkey from your Thanksgiving dinner, why not use it to make a delicious pot pie? Simply substitute the chicken in the recipe with turkey and add in some of your favorite vegetables like carrots, peas, and celery. This is a great way to use up any leftover turkey you may have and enjoy a comforting and flavorful meal.
2. Vegetarian Pot Pie
If you’re vegetarian or looking to cut back on your meat consumption, you can still enjoy a delicious pot pie. Swap the chicken for tofu or your favorite vegetables like sweet potato, mushroom, and spinach. You can even use a vegetarian cream or milk to make your sauce. The possibilities are endless, and you can create a unique pot pie that is entirely your own.
3. Seafood Pot Pie
For a delicious twist on the classic dish, why not try making a seafood pot pie? Mix shrimp, crab, and fish into your pie filling, along with some onions and garlic, for a mouth-watering seafood dish. Top it off with a buttery, flaky crust and you’ll have a seafood feast that is sure to impress.
4. Mini Pot Pies
If you’re looking for a fun and creative way to serve up your pot pie, try making mini pot pies. Simply cut the dough into smaller circles and use a muffin tin to bake your pies. They’re perfect for serving as an appetizer or party dish, and make a great lunchbox for kids.
5. Mexican-Inspired Pot Pie
If you want to add a little bit of spice to your pot pie, why not try incorporating some Mexican flavors? Add in some cumin, chili powder, and black beans to give your pot pie a little kick. You can also serve it with some fresh avocado and cilantro for a flavorful twist.
